Ever find yourself mentally replaying the same situation over and over again? From second-guessing that conversation with your kid to obsessing over whether you handled something "the right way"—welcome to the exhausting world of rumination.
In this episode, we’re digging into why our brains get stuck on repeat, what it costs us emotionally, and how to finally shift the loop. Whether it’s mom guilt, overwhelm, or just the never-ending mental load—we’re talking about how to get unstuck and reclaim your peace (and your brain space).
